Abstract
The isocratic retention of cyclic β-amino acids is studied on a chiral crown ether column (Crownpak CR[+]) at different temperatures. The natural logarithm of the retention factor (In k) depends linearly on the inverse of temperature (1/T). van't Hoff plots afford thermodynamic parameters, such as the apparent change of enthalpy (ΔH°) and the apparent change of entropy (ΔS°) for the transfer of analyte from the mobile phase to the stationary phase. The information obtained from the thermodynamic study is discussed, and the qualitative relationships between the structure and the thermodynamic data are evaluated.
